Josh Johnson

With more than 16 years of TP advisory experience, Mr. Johnson has deep expertise assisting clients across all aspects of the discipline. This includes TP compliance and reporting (e.g., economic benchmarking; TP documentation; country-by-country reporting), more complex advisory matters (e.g., cross-border financing; intellectual property/intangibles pricing and migrations; TP model design, implementation, and operation/monitoring; business restructuring/M&A), and tax authority disputes/negotiations (e.g., advance pricing arrangements; audits; mutual agreement procedure negotiations).
Prior to joining A&M, Mr. Johnson was with PwC, where he most recently served as a Director in PwC Australia’s TP team. Mr. Johnson worked with a large number of inbound and outbound multinational clients across a broad range of industries, such as fast-moving consumer goods, luxury goods, consumer appliances, software, industrial products, automotive, pharmaceuticals, renewables, agriculture, infrastructure, property, and financial services. He advised clients at all business life cycle stages, including startup, high-growth, and mature businesses, providing tailored advice suited to each scenario.
Mr. Johnson earned a bachelor’s degree in agricultural economics (honors) from the University of Sydney and an MBA (finance) from the University of Technology Sydney.
